

Antioxidant Superfood
Futurebiotics
Overview
The supplement provides a broad spectrum of ingredients known for their antioxidant properties. While individual components like Mangosteen, Green Tea Extract, Grape Seed Extract, and Pomegranate Extract have research-backed benefits at adequate doses, the use of proprietary blends for the 'Proprietary High ORAC Compound' and 'ORAC Fruit & Vegetable Blend' makes it impossible to verify if each specific ingredient within these blends is present at clinically effective levels. The total ORAC unit claim (5000 ORAC units per daily dose) is a positive indicator for overall antioxidant capacity, but ORAC values do not always directly translate to in-vivo efficacy. The 'BioAccelerators' containing Bioperine, Digezyme, and Lactospore are well-regarded for enhancing bioavailability and aiding digestion, which is a good addition for a complex blend like this.
The Good
Broad Spectrum Antioxidant Support: Contains a wide array of fruit and vegetable extracts known for high ORAC values and antioxidant properties, promoting comprehensive cellular protection.
Enhanced Bioavailability: Inclusion of BioPerine and other BioAccelerators is designed to improve the absorption of beneficial compounds, maximizing the supplement's potential effectiveness.
Digestive Health Support: Digezyme and LactoSpore contribute to improved digestion and gut health, which can positively impact overall wellness and nutrient utilization.
The Bad
Proprietary Blend Concerns: The majority of the key beneficial ingredients are hidden within proprietary blends (Proprietary High ORAC Compound, ORAC Fruit & Vegetable Blend), making it impossible to ascertain the exact dose of each component and whether they reach therapeutic levels.
Potential Drug Interactions: Grapefruit Extract and Trikatu (containing piperine and gingerols) can interact with various medications, particularly those metabolized by CYP3A4, requiring caution and medical consultation.
Caffeine Content from Green Tea Extract: While not specified, Green Tea Extract typically contains caffeine, which might be a concern for individuals sensitive to stimulants or those looking for a stimulant-free product.
